Atenas is only forty-five minutes from the country’s capital, San Jose. Located in the central highlands of Costa Rica, the town is made up of 5,000 residents and is central to Costa Rican history and culture.
The scenery is laid-back and stunning; many of the residents base their livelihood on growing mangoes, coffee and oranges. Agriculture is the country’s main economic revenue.
